The 3D8W4_1.6RP series is a family of cost effective and high performanced
3W single & dual output DC-DC converters. These converters are built in non-
conductive black plastic package in a 8-pin DIL miniature compact case with high
performance features wide range devices operate over 4:1 input voltage range
providing stable output voltage. Devices are encapsulated using flame retardant
resin. Input voltages of 12, 24, 48 Vdc with output voltage of 3.3, 5, 12, 15, 5, 12,
15 Vdc. High performance features include high efficiency operation up to 84%
and output voltage accuracy of 1% maꢀimum.

Example:
3D8W4_1205S1.6RP
3 = 3Watt; D8 = DIP8; W4 = Wide input (4:1); 12 = 12Vin; 05 = 5Vout;
S = Single output; 1.6= 1.6kVDC; R= Regulated output; P= Short circuit
protection
